Rice Price in Cipinang Market is Stable

The intensity of rainfall that occurred lately starts to affect the rice supply to Cipinang Rice Market, East Jakarta. Despite fluctuations, the price in the market tends to be stable and still within reasonable limits.

The current rice price is stable so far

PT Food Station Tjipinang Director, Arief Prasetyo Adi disclosed, the current rice price is relatively stable. Although it rises, it will be Rp 100 per kg. If it is compared to last month, the price hike was only one percent. But if it is compared to last year, it was only declining three percent. Fluctuations of rice price are deemed reasonable because of the weather and the harvest season.

"The current rice price is stable so far," he stated, Wednesday (10/5).

According to him, rice stock is currently 43 tons. It is still safe or still meet the food needs of citizens until the end of the year. Moreover, every day, the supply will continue to be supplied from local suppliers.

Ayong (52), a rice seller said rice price is very stable. "It is still deserted from buyer, perhaps it is due to rain season. But, indeed, it always happens after Eid ul Adha," he expressed.

He assessed, the rice sale has declined between 30-40 percent. The indication is, if the rice distributes 30 tons per day, but now it is only 20 tons.

Based on the data, rice price type IR 1 Rp 10,000 per kg, IR 2 Rp 8,800 per kg, IR 3 Rp 7,900 per kg and IR 42 Rp 10,800 per kg.
